List and describe Carl Jung’s four problem-solving styles. Identify a profession that would be associated with each and speculate as to why.

What will be an ideal response?


Sensation-thinking: emphasizes details, facts, certainty; is a decisive, applied thinker; focuses on short-term, realistic goals; develops rules and regulations for judging performance.Professions: accounting; production; software engineers; market research; engineering Intuitive-thinking: prefers dealing with theoretical or technical problems; is a creative, progressive, perceptive thinker; focuses on possibilities using impersonal analysis; is able to consider a number of options and problems simultaneously.Professions: systems design; Internet security; law; middle/top management; teaching business, economics Sensation-feeling: shows concern for current, real-life human problems; is pragmatic, analytical, methodical, and conscientious; emphasizes detailed facts about people rather than tasks; focuses on structuring organizations for the benefit of people.Professions: directing supervisor; counseling; negotiating; selling; interviewing Intuitive-feeling: avoids specifics; is charismatic, participative, people-oriented, and helpful; focuses on general views, broad themes, and feelings; decentralizes decision making; develops few rules and regulations.Professions: public relations; advertising; human resources; politics; customer service Reasoning will vary but should relate the problem-solving style to the tasks associated with the profession.
